Bad vibration after new clutch
Help
I can't figure out why my transmission just vibrates between 3.2k-2.5k rpm after installing the new clutch. Inspected everything & they look great..... I was so annoyed I changed a transmission.......it got better but it's still there. Is it possible that the new flywheel is out of balance? |
